My understanding is that every class has at least one ability that can be used when Frozen and/or can break Frozen. In the Wizard's case, you can use Diamond Skin to absorb damage while you're Frozen and Mirror Images to break Frozen, if you wish.

And that's how the game should be. It's fine to have difficult mechanics, provided that the player is armed with tools to counter or combat those mechanics. The game should expect that every player has 2-3 active defensive skills plus some sort of aura/armor and 2-3 offensive skills to cycle through depending on the situation. However, it may be that the skill counters versus mob mechanics balance isn't there, yet. It sounds like the Wizard has the best selection of useful defensive abilities (Diamond Skin, Teleport, Frost Nova, Mirror Images, Wave of Force) that counter mob mechanics. Other classes (especially Demon Hunters) should have their defensive skills improved to match that kind of defensive skill selection. Also, elite packs should probably have their cooldowns on their special abilities increased a little to take into account the fact that they spawn in large packs. Or perhaps packs should have some kind of "pack global cooldown" triggered when a member casts a special attack.
